Saranac High School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Saranac High School in the United States is $87,042.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Saranac High School typically range from $76,103 to $99,624 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Grand Rapids?

Understanding the cost of living near Grand Rapids is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Saranac High School.
Grand Rapids' Cost of Living Index is approximately 89.5 (10.5% less expensive than US average; 2.0% less than MI average). Western MI city, growing, affordable housing. The Rapid b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Saranac High School,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Saranac High School sal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(The Rapid mon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,210 - $3,580+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
